Output 3071650294098d8acdcd45f140d59952aa764e24182cc266f12c91a825550c6b:273

value
18856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45f0f3f5d5c999f670d30a9ce992ac2eb3c995e OP_EQUAL
address
3Py8gCoz8TFpon2GPDymEqBeuiScbhmXf4
transaction
3071650294098d8acdcd45f140d59952aa764e24182cc266f12c91a825550c6b
spent
true